How good is airport security?

So how good is airport security in the U.S.? The latest report shows that the TSA is sorely lacking in its core mission to intercept weapons, explosives, and ammunition. About 97 percent of the time the TSA failed to detect guns, weapons, and explosives.

How important is safety?

A safe and healthy workplace not only protects workers from injury and illness, it can also lower injury/illness costs, reduce absenteeism and turnover, increase productivity and quality, and raise employee morale. In other words, safety is good for business. Plus, protecting workers is the right thing to do.

What is the main health and safety law?

The basis of British health and safety law is the Health and Safety at Work etc Act 1974. The Act sets out the general duties which employers have towards employees and members of the public, and employees have to themselves and to each other.

Who is responsible for Health & Safety in the workplace?

Business owners and employers are legally responsible for health and safety management. This means they need to make sure that employees, and anyone who visits their premises, are protected from anything that may cause harm, and control any risks to injury or health that could arise in the workplace

Who needs OSHA training?

Workers who fall under the definition of “construction workers” must receive training about certain job-specific safety concerns, such as general safety & health provisions, personal protective equipment, fall protection and other topics as defined by OSHA standards.
